Guys, the Mc Girt addition is the kiss of death for Rahman, but don't be fooled by the weigh in.

He weighed in fully clothed with a double T shirt; that would make his real weight around 250 or a little less.

For a guy who only had 1 month to prepare, it's not that bad. That's not top shape, but don't assume Rock just came for the paycheck; he will still try to land his right for about 4-5 rds.

With Wlad being the cautious fighter he is, the minus 6.5 rds is a bit risky.
I think 8 rd KO.
